Job Title / Qualifications: International Assignment Consultant

Reports To: Client Services Manager

Primary Function:

International Relocation Service provider for Global Clients and taking ownership of high quality Client driven services for their employees internationally.

The Consultant serves as the navigator and owner of the assignment process for their international assignees. Provide subject matter expertise in relation to all assignment–related issues. Responsibilities may include administration of client’s mobility policy/program; delivering expatriate compensation-related services, counselling on best utilization of resources (i.e. language and cross-cultural trainings); coordinating the shipment of household goods, destination services, expense management, etc. while ensuring customer and client needs are met in a timely, efficient manner through delivery of Top Block service, the highest accolade that an assignee can give.

Major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Provide single point of co-ordination for all phases of International relocation activities, administering and policing client policy on behalf of client as outlined in their specific policies

  • Provide impeccable customer service to assignee and their family

  • Coordinate the delivery of services and manage vendors as dictated by client policy

  • Counsel employees to the best utilization of program benefits

  • Demonstrate sound knowledge of products and services

  • Dealing with Client’s employees on a day to day basis in accordance with their policy

  • Deliver the International Relocation products and services to the employee

  • Strive to maintain Cartus’ position as the Market Leader by continuing to deliver exceptional customer services

  • Participate in special projects as needed, including client presentations and client/supplier training

  • Identify growth opportunities and refer it to the Account Management Team

  • Be responsible for the co-ordination of Cartus Services, i.e., language, and cross-cultural training.

  • To counsel the employee on their payroll benefits and partner closely with client Payroll teams to ensure seamless service delivery

  • Interpret customer needs while balancing client policy; proactively maintain communication with assignee and client throughout assignment life cycle

  • Demonstrate knowledge of policy and programs in all interactions with client

  • Recommend enhancements to client policy, dependant on the client you are working with.

  • Evaluate client policy and recommend revisions and customization as appropriate

  • Provide consultative expertise regarding industry best practices and program administration

  • Research information to assist clients in the development of new and existing international policies and compensation programs.

  • Develop and maintain all pertinent records and ad hoc reports for management review and decision making

  • Maintain and Manage relationships with Cartus’ internal departments and external suppliers/partners in regards to reaching the clients expectations

  • Proactively seek opportunities to resolve unique customer concerns and needs; identify opportunities for enhancement to current client processes.

  • Ensure 100% accuracy and data integrity in all Cartus systems

  • Maintain compliance with Cartus’ core values, practices, and standards

  • Assist with the development and training of Train new internal personnel

Cartus (https://cartus.com/en/) is leaning into its essence, Where Mobility Meets Agility®. With nearly 70 years in operation, Cartus is an industry leader in global talent mobility and corporate relocation services. Cartus manages all aspects of an employee’s move across 190+ countries to facilitate a smooth transition in what otherwise may be a stressful process. The company supports hundreds of corporate and government clients—including more than a third of Fortune 100 companies—with domestic and international mobility, recruitment and talent management, outsourcing, policy consulting and DEI mobility solutions, international assignment compensation and gross-up services, remote and hybrid workforce solutions, and language and intercultural solutions. Cartus is a subsidiary of Anywhere Real Estate Inc.
